Biography

Dorris de Vocht is an associate professor and member of the management team at the Department of Criminal Law. She obtained her Master's in Criminal Law (cum laude) and a doctorate from Maastricht University. Dorris has extensive teaching and research experience in the fields of criminal and procedural law with a strong focus on comparative criminal procedure. She is involved in European studies on procedural safeguards, including the project 'Young Suspects Interrogation'. Her current research explores the impact of communication technology and digital means in criminal courtrooms. Dorris is also the co-founder of the International Virtual Criminal Justice Network. In addition to her academic work, she serves as a substitute judge at the Limburg Court.
